Chromeo Remix Vampire Weekend

MTVU Woodie Awards 2008: Vampire Weekend
As they promised at the Woodies , Chromeo have done a number on Vampire Weekend's "The Kids Don't Stand A Chance," and it sounds absolutely nothing like the version they performed with their Columbia brethren later that night. It's a fun listen -- syncopation and synths run rampant, the signature guitar line gets a keyboard makeover with some new chord movement in the mix.
